Transaction ed52cc6a12aadc196913050d246709023fc8a8e4e74255f639ff410f96a34079
1 Input
1 Output
-
ed52cc6a12aadc196913050d246709023fc8a8e4e74255f639ff410f96a34079:0
- value
- 4998244
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e1da2cf087bac311b1eef3a7d10a6cf8b14d4ba
- address
- bc1q3cw69ncg0wkrzxc7aua86y9xe793f496nv2kl0